No more than the glass window top costs, can be had on ebay for $699, it makes sense to go with the glass and not ever have to mess with replacing the back window again imo. My window seems to have been replaced as I can see the yellowed one that was just cut out, it has developed a rip in the window and is moving towards the cloth now. I'm just going to buy a glass window top and call it good. The later models have a glass window anyway, it makes it look newer.
